Experience the magic of winter nights with a guided snowshoe tour at Sun Peaks. Walk under the stars, spot wildlife tracks, and end with delicious s'mores by a crackling fire.
Wear moisture-wicking and insulating layers to stay warm and dry during the snowshoe.
A headlamp or flashlight helps navigate the trail after dark safely.
Ensure clear nights for optimal star gazing and trail safety.
Getting to the meeting point with time to spare ensures a relaxed start.
Sun Peaks has a rich Indigenous heritage, and the area was traditionally used by the Secwepemc people for hunting and gathering.
